MA Filmmaking (Editing)

Overview

This Masters will enhance your narrative skills as an editor of fiction for film and television.


Key Features

  • This Masters is a pathway of MA Filmmaking, so that in addition to your specialised training you will collaborate with students across all specialisms on a variety of film projects.
  • Experienced tutors and guests provide expert guidance designed to enhance the flow of your individual research, experimentation and artistic achievement.
  • You will complete your degree by working in your specialist role on a major production in the final term.
  • The programme is housed in a new purpose-built media facility equipped with state-of-the art teaching spaces including a film studio equipped with Arri lighting and Green Screen facilities.
  • Goldsmiths is an Avid Learning Partner offering Editing students accredited training in Media Composer and the opportunity to certify as an Avid Media Composer Specialist. Edit suites, screening rooms and sound studios are linked via Avid’s industry standard NEXIS storage area network.
  • You will work to professional standards using high-end digital formats. You will also learn sophisticated postproduction workflow techniques, gaining a wealth of experience in off-line editing and an understanding of how this fits in with on-line editing, visual effects and picture grading.
  • In addition to your specialist area, you can attend classes in related disciplines. This framework is designed to stimulate collaborative practice by providing you with a breadth of filmmaking knowledge combined with a high level of expertise in your chosen filmmaking discipline.

Entry Requirements

You should have (or expect to be awarded) an undergraduate degree of at least 2:1 standard in a relevant/related subject. You might also be considered if you aren’t a graduate or your degree is in an unrelated field, but you have relevant experience and can show you can work at postgraduate level.

Expert Guidance

Tutors on the MA Filmmaking course have a wealth of experience in the film and television industry. We maintain close links with the industry – the editing department has, for the last few years, had a strong relationship with the Guild of British Film and Television Editors who have provided mentors for our students.


What You'll Study

Specialist Studies

You will take the following modules:


  • Editing: Specialist Skills (30 credits)
  • Contemporary Screen Narratives (15 credits)

Optional Modules

You will choose three optional modules, worth 45 credits in total.


Examples of recent optional modules include:


  • Social Activist Film (15 credits)
  • Archaeology of the Moving Image (PG, 15 credits)
  • Camera Fundamentals (15 credits)
  • Film Producing Fundamentals (15 credits)
  • Representing Reality (15 credits)
  • Sound Design Fundamentals (15 credits)
  • The Ascent of the Image (15 credits)
  • Doctor Holby: Writing for Existing Continuing TV Drama Series (15 credits)
  • Media Law and Ethics
  • Practical Law for Film-makers (15 credits)

Final Project

You will complete a Final Project (90 credits), assessed by a portfolio of work and a viva that reflects your practice.


Overview

For two terms you will spend a full day a week in specialised contact with your specific programme convenor. These sessions include:


  • Practical demonstrations and exercises
  • Lectures
  • Screenings
  • Small group seminars
  • Workshops

You will also take three optional modules, taught through practical workshops and hands-on experiences, as well as critical discussion and essay writing.


The third term will be taken up with your substantive Final Project and you will take part in a series of progress and feedback meetings.


Group Film Projects

You will work with other students from across the five MA Filmmaking fiction pathways to create film crews in a professional structure.


This allows you to develop realistic industry experience while making work with extremely high production values.

If English isn’t your first language, you will need an IELTS score (or equivalent English language qualification) of 7.0 with a 7.0 in writing and no element lower than 6.5 to study this programme.


Careers

On completing the programme, you will be equipped to enter the global job market, armed with an enhanced understanding of your practical, intellectual and creative capacities as a film editor.


Possibly the most important skill we furnish you with is the rigorous discipline of working collaboratively under pressure as part of a creative team on challenging projects not only in film and television, but also in online, web, multi-media, animation, games and other hybrid forms.


In addition to your practical filmmaking skills, we enable you to develop a variety of transferable intellectual, organisational and communication skills to equip you for a broad range of employment opportunities across the arts and media landscape (film, television, online, the creative arts, advertising and related hybrid forms).


Our Graduates

Our alumni are active in the film, media and cultural industries around the world as fiction and documentary editors.
